SCANDINAVIA SCENE OF HJTkER'S NEW PROBLEM. Tt is reported that the Allied forces are probably operating along the Gudbrandsdal Valley. This valley runs from the Povre Fjeld in a south-easterly direction to Lake Mjosa, northward of Oslo. It.should be noted ' that in Scandinavian languages the letter "j" is pronounced as a short "i" or "y."
